Items html ext js download

How to create a checkboxes inside checkboxgroup in extjs and query the current selections we have created a bunch of checkboxes with the same name and then wrap them inside a checkboxgroup layout container. Build a website gui using extjs javascript website design. Alternate class names are commonly maintained for backward compatibility. Sencha ext js is the most comprehensive javascript framework for building. Sep 10, 2011 extjs tree filter filtering tree items in extjs 4 download source code from here. Ill keep the introduction to ext js brief, and then give a short primer to using ext. Download the trial version of ext js library files from sencha you will. Developing web applications in the ext js framework.

Thus, is there a way to download a file using ajax when the file is not present at the server physically. Just fill out the simple form and start your download. Dec 05, 2016 contribute to bjornharrtellextjs development by creating an account on github. This tip is just for beginners who want to start working with extjs in web applications. Html elements and other nonext js react components are wrapped in an ext. After a few months i think i have a fundamental understanding of vanilla js, html, css, php, an sql and have been able to make some very basic websites. It can be used as a simple component framework to, for example, create dynamic grids on otherwise static pages, but also as a full framework for building singlepage applications.

Download the trial version of ext js library files from sencha com. Extjs file upload panel elvis is still in the building. Extjs custom build with selected components rahul singla. Alternate name one or more additional class name synonymns in ext js 6. Hello, i have to focus cursor on the first item of the page, however the item is modified by ext js, therefore when i do it the usual way set it in display attributes it does not work. By continuing to use pastebin, you agree to our use of cookies as described in the cookies policy. The gridpanel loaded from the partial view wont anchor 100% to the center region specified in the viewport it grows the size of the items on the grid and overflows offscreen. While one can use ext js as a prebuilt javascript and css file, your real world applications will greatly benefit by starting on a scalable foundation of tools that can produce optimized builds for your endusers. You can think of the extjs application as just more static assets served by node like css or html pages. Get a head start on your application testing by trying sencha tests free 30 day trial.

We need to write two different code for ie based browsers and rest of all. Page title is optional here and can be adjusted any way you want it. These containers can have multiple layout to arrange the components in the containers. Extjs remove item of a store javascript, extjs,extjs5 in a extjs app i have a tree panel that reads an json file, in the tree panel i have a check box that execute an action, additionally i save the checked element in a grid panel of a tab panel. Cursor focus on an item modified by ext js oracle community.

Ext js 5 introduces support for the mvvm architecture as well as improvements on the c in mvc. If you want to display multiple fields in the display of an ext js combobox, you will want to use the listconfigs itemtpl like so. Container in ext js is the component where we can add other container or child components. To disable waiaria compatibility warnings, override ext. Skip to the charts section if youre already familiar with ext. Razor how to add items to a panel from a partial view ext. Sencha ext js is the most comprehensive javascript framework for building dataintensive, crossplatform web and mobile applications for any modern device. If both values are not equal, i want to return true, otherwise i want to return false. We use cookies for various purposes including analytics. When installing the plugin, it downloads and installs automatically the latest ext 2. It will be automatically added to your manning account within 24 hours of purchase.

Ext js leverages html5 features on modern browsers while maintaining compatibility and functionality for legacy browsers. Ext js is a pure javascript application framework for building interactive cross platform web applications using techniques such as ajax, dhtml and dom scripting. This guide provides instructions for getting your environment ready for ext js 6 development. Please let me know how it is possible to focus cursor in this case. Get more with manning an ebook copy of the previous edition, ext js in action first edition, is included at no additional cost. It autowires the dependency modules within the html elements. Personal information title mr first name xyz middle last name zyz birth. Download ext js from senchas website, extract its content to your project folder and rename obtained directory to ext4. Just to add that i have a long list of parameters which i need to send to the server and hence can not add them all to the src of iframe. So i ended up making an extension from a grid panel with dnd and multiple files upload field.

Example directory structure used in this tutorial is shown in the image below. It can be used as a simple component framework to, for example, create. Class documentation, guides and videos on how to create javascript applications with ext js 4. The classic toolkit contains the traditional pieces of the ext js codebase that supports legacy browsers, tablets, and touch screen laptops. It had the complete revised structure, which was followed by mvc architecture and a speedy application. Instead of creating the main application initializing script app. On the other hand, turning html into an ext js component allows us to use it the same way as any other ext js component for example, participate in layouts. Ext js 6 by sencha the good, the bad, and the ugly dzone. Is anybody have experience with ext js in relation to apex. Extjs reusable dropdownlist for any form field rahul. Thank you, worked perfectly although there is a strange behavior. How to get selected text from textareatext input in ext js. It is a javascript framework and a product of sencha, based on yui yahoo user interface. We recommend extracting ext js into a senchasdks folder in your home directory.

This toolkit is designed for mobile devices and modern desktop browsers, such as chrome, firefox, edge, safari and ie11. Html is full of tags that makes it complex and difficult to debug. Or skip straight to the end if you just want to see the final demo. Declarative templates with databinding, mvw, mvvm, mvc, dependency injection and great testability story all implemented with pure clientside javascript. Component is the lightest way of including any arbitrary html markup. Open tooling sign up for a 30day free trial download of sencha ext js a comprehensive javascript framework for dataintensive, crossplatform web apps development. In extjs first we need to select dom element of textarea and that can be done using inputel. Following is a simple syntax to create html editor. Sencha ext js create dataintensive html5 applications using javascript. To achieve this goal, we will dive into a media player app built by sencha. The modern toolkit contains a touchfriendly codebase that supports modern browsers, tablets, and phones. Extjs provides a library of javascript based classes that provides almost everything that is required to develop a web application ui components, css compiler, ajax, layouts.

Sencha ext js comprehensive javascript framework and ui. Here is a good read for all possible ext scripts depending on how you wish to useread. A while ago, i tried to create a reusable file upload management panel for the internal intranet system. I have been doing custom builds of extjs for clients these days, who want to use only selected components from the toolkit, and therefore a trimmed down version of the ext all.

We start by outlining how to download and configure the ext js library. Ext js provides the industrys most comprehensive collection of highperformance, customizable ui widgets including html5 grids, trees, lists, forms, menus, toolbars, panels, windows, and much more. Hi i am having a link which if i paste to the browser asks me to download a file as xls. If nothing happens, download github desktop and try again. However, my base field was a textarea instead of a singleline textfield, and i needed to provide selectable items in a dropdownlist as text is inputted. How compatible is this program with frontpage 2003. Here i am going to explain about getting selected text string from a extjs html textareatextinput. This plugin provides integration with the ext javascript library. Extjs 4 xml tree view example how to build a tree view using xml data from java servlet and mysql database.

Intelligence analyst for the us army, cutter began learning html while stationed. Ext js in action, second edition teaches ext js from the ground up. In extjs best practices i gone through not to use id for accessing ext components rather use itemid, i am very new in accessing components using itemid, does any one can help me in default syntax or the way to access components also on click of yes in a message box i need to disable some components in masked page, whether this can be achieved with the help of itemid. On windows the part of the path will be replaced by something like c. These utility classes include items like sound management, a video player panel. There is less html generated in ext js 6 than there was in ext js 4, but it is still relatively ugly. As you can imagine, whilst deeplynested extjs code can quickly become dif. Java software for your computer, or the java runtime environment, is also referred to as the java runtime, runtime environment, runtime, jre, java virtual machine, virtual machine, java vm, jvm, vm, java plugin, java plugin, java addon or java download. Angularjs is what html would have been, had it been designed for building webapps. This is an example of how to use ext js 4 and jquery in an application together to use ext js 4 with any js frameowork is very simple. The media player app needs some higher privileges to render the ext js. My websites are pretty ugly and i could not imagine anyone paying for them. Use these examples to build your crossplatform apps for desktop, tablets, and smartphones.

Extjs and angularjs are the two industry leading frameworks for rich ui development. Debugging tool that provides direct access to components, classes, objects. With this setting saved, you can download later versions of ext js into. Custom css styles javascript scrolling menu custom css styles javascript scrolling menu dojo tree widget xmlstore extjs asynchronous tree. Contribute to israelroldanextjsreactor development by creating an account on github. This property is provided for backward compatibility with previous versions of ext js. The goal of this doc is to get you started on building chrome apps with the sencha ext js framework. I thought you could do this with the content tag but this doesnt seem to work. It is basically a desktop application development platform with modern ui.

It also discusses the other software that is required before you can complete and publish your first project. It contains the objects which binds the store data to view. This guide covers ext js creating an application using the zip download. Contribute to sencha extjsexamplescoworkee development by creating an account on github. We can add or remove components from container and from its child elements. Donwload extjs on this page we find two download options. To display a web link, basically an url, all you need to do is write a custom renderer function for the extjs grid column that you want as s. This tutorial gives a complete understanding of ext js. Here is an example which docks a toolbar above a grid. Fill our form for a 30day free trial download of sencha ext js a comprehensive javascript framework for dataintensive, crossplatform web apps development. It also contains two helper tags to easily include additional ext javascript and css files as well. Mongo admin the mongo web admin is a extjs web application for developers to use while developing web applicatio.

While we encourage you to investigate and take advantage of these improvements, it is important to note that we have made every effort to ensure existing ext js 4 mvc applications continue to. After the release of ext js 3, the developers of ext js had the major challenge of ramping up the speed. Should we need two servers to run ext js application with node. Make it easy for people to find samples unlimited items in tree extjs. This ext js ui widget is to create a html editor so that the user can edit a piece of information in terms of font, color, size, etc. This time i needed to provide a dropdown list with selectable options exactly as you see for an extjs combobox. A tree structure is a way of representing the hierarchical nature of a structure in a graphical form. A drag operation, essentially, is a click gesture on some ui. Sep 08, 2016 today, were pleased to announce that sencha architect 4. Orders a model can have many order items another model each record of orders is stored in store each record of orders points to another store that has its order items this allows us to select an order, and then immediately have access to all its order items extjs view since this is javascript, we immediately expect robust gui widgets. Extjs 4 easywrapper for php extjs is a really cool javascript library for generating web guis. Ext js 4 is advancement in javascript framework featuring expanded functionality, plugin free charting, and a new mvc architecture. Ext js 6 by sencha the good, the bad, and the ugly.

In this guide we will be starting from scratch and creating an ext js 6. I do the same thing all the time using node, java, and python applications. Ext js 4 delivers its users a nasty piece of mvc structure which makes it more readable than it was in version 3. To use extjs, we first need to download the same through the following link.

Extjs is a javascript framework provided by sencha to develop interactive web applications. With a single command, youll have a fully functional universal starter application that can be run on a local web server. I set the tree two nodes expanded true, while in the previous web projects using the menu structure is tree like. Did you know that it took months of hard work and two full weeks of vacation time to bring this awesome plugin to you completly free. Buy extjs easy php wrapper by wapathemes on codecanyon. A tree structure is a way of representing the hierarchical nature of. What i want to do is completely basic, i want to use ext.

61 114 871 735 1340 1184 1489 129 783 307 704 717 694 596 1399 1224 380 276 756 886 176 26 1411 1479 314 1406 320 58 400 1346 965 804 1132 791 1230 212 681 931 616 1067 567 1444 521 1194 454 204